Ms. Mettam inquires about service interruptions to the Rottnest Island booking system. The answer details multiple outages affecting the online system between October 2018 and March 2019, with some impacting the service provider's clients across the Asia-Pacific region.

I refer to the
Rottnest Island booking system, and ask: (a) Since
11 October 2018, have there been any service interruptions to: (i) the online booking system; and (ii) the phone booking system; and (b) If yes to (a) on what dates did the service interruptions occur and what was the extent of these interruptions?

(a)
(i)        Yes
(ii)       No
(b)     1 November 2018 – approximately 2 hours: this outage affected clients of the service provider with comparable systems throughout the Asia-Pacific region.
12 November 2018 – approximately 6 hours.
13 November 2018 – approximately 12 hours.
9 - 10 January 2019 – approximately 24.75 hours: this outage affected clients of the service provider with comparable systems throughout the Asia-Pacific region.
20 January 2019 – approximately 21.5 hours: this outage affected clients of the service provider with comparable systems throughout the Asia-Pacific region.
15 February 2019 – approximately 0.5 hour.
21 February 2019 – approximately 1.5 hours.
22 February 2019 – approximately 4 hours.
22 February 2019 – approximately 3.5 hours.
14 March 2019 – approximately 3.5 hours.
29 March 2019 – approximately 10.5 hours.
On the above dates there was disrupted access to book RIA accommodation via www.rottnestisland.com .  Accommodation could still be booked via alternative online travel agents (subject to availability).
